Glimpses of Resonating Nordnes at BEK

Thanks for dropping by BEK during Resonating Nordnes on Sunday 20 March! We counted more than 100 visitors throughout the day, enjoying a Radio Multe 93.8FM broadcast about Nordnes history from our listening station or taking part in a family workshop on sound making. The events at BEK were a part of Resonating Nordnes and Borealis 2022. More on the Radio…

BEK Opening Week 2022: Lars Ove Toft – ‘like Night and Day’ (fully booked!)

As a part of BEK Opening Week 2022, we invite small groups for screenings of Lars Ove Toft’s new installation ‘like Night and Day’. The installation stages how a room is being transformed by light and darkness. Presence is shifting, what is distinct changes and objects appear translucent and mutable. BEK Opening Week 2022: BEK Works in progress

Each year, more than 40 local and international artists visit BEK for work residencies in our sound and video studios and electronics lab. Practising artists are also a part of our organisation, and we run workshops where creative practitioners from Norway and the world learn new skills and exchange ideas. BEK Symposium: The Only Lasting Truth is Change

The Only Lasting Truth is Change: programme 19–20 November

The Only Lasting Truth is Change is an extended symposium investigating future configurations of art, technology, nature and power. Collecting all the symposium threads and projects on 19–20 November, BEK invites you to an intensive two-day programme of discussions and performances, radio broadcasts and screenings, recipes and diagrams. With contributions by Anna L. Tsing, Lucia Pietroiusti, Stephanie Dinkins, Mark Fell…
